How Much do Concrete Coatings Cost?

The answer to the question, “How much do concrete coatings cost?” depends on a range of factors. The rule of thumb is that they retail generally for somewhere between $30 and $45 per gallon.

Some factors to consider: How long would you like your concrete coating to last? What kind of texture and color are you looking for? Most importantly, what do you want it to protect against?

 

Types of Concrete Coating

Most concrete coatings fall into one of two categories: thin-film and thick-film. Thin concrete coatings usually go on in layers that are about one millimeter thick; the thicker ones average closer to two or three millimeters.

Some concrete coatings penetrate the surface of the concrete to seal it against different things that can damage it, especially moisture. Even the thin-film coatings can penetrate up to four inches.

 

Benefits of Concrete Coatings

Just about every time a concrete coating is used, it’s for protection, aesthetics, or both.

There are all sorts of things to protect a concrete floor from–after all, we use concrete because it’s already so durable on its own. Four of the most common predators to concrete that we coat it to fend off are chemicals, abrasion, impact, and temperature fluctuations (also called thermal shock).
